Do HGH Pills Really Work?
Human Growth Hormone, commonly referred to as HGH, helps your body develop during childhood years into early adulthood. Produced in the pituitary gland, HGH works to regulate a variety of processes within the body, including healthy tissue repair. The natural production of HGH begins to slow during middle age which causes various health issues over time. Taking HGH supplements combats this decline by providing you with an added boost of this beneficial hormone which helps you build muscle and boosts your immune system. Are Soft Gels Better Than Tablets?
Dietary supplements and oral medications come in capsule or tablet formulations and deliver an active ingredient to your digestive tract for a specific reason. Capsules and tablets have similarities and differences, and consequently advantages and disadvantages. Depending on your needs, one format may be better suited for you than the other. 30 days on Vitamin C-Moss
What is Vitamin C-Moss? Vitamin C-Moss is 1000mg of Vitamin C, 600mg of seamoss, and 400mg of green tea. The body utilizes Vitamin C to make tendons, ligaments, and blood vessels. Vitamin C is also used to maintain cartilage, heal wounds, and to form scar tissue. It is important to know that the body is not able to make vitamin C on its own, so make sure to eat foods or take supplements that provide it in your diet.
